Tarrant County adopts new rules for renting facilities amid Fort Worth event controversy
Tarrant County has a new policy in place to regulate the use of county facilities by private groups and individuals. County staff created the policy to “ensure that county facilities are utilized for the efficient operation of government business and to ensure the safety of all employees and members of the public who are present at said facilities,” according to the seven-page document. The policy, which county commissioners approved July 16, will go into effect Aug. 1.

Rare crocodiles hatch at the Fort Worth Zoo. Here’s what makes them so special.
FORT WORTH, Texas - The Fort Worth Zoo is celebrating a major milestone in its conservation efforts. On Wednesday, the zoo announced the birth of two gharial crocodiles. The gharial is a type of river crocodile from India with a long, thin snout. They’re also one of the largest crocodile species in the world, growing to about 16 feet long and 1,500 pounds.
